SSRS IIF表达仅给出部分输出

时间:2018-02-21 20:27:57

标签: reporting-services expression ssrs-2012 iif

我有一个简单的IIF声明,如果实际日期是空白,请告诉我TBC。否则,请告诉我实际日期是什么。我可以成功获得TBC。但是我无法得到实际的日期来显示我知道哪里有约会。任何帮助表示赞赏。

=IIF(Fields!VPSR_Actual_Date.Value = "", "TBC", Fields!VPSR_Actual_Date.Value)

1 个答案:

答案 0 :(得分:1)

我会检查列是否为空或零字符串,然后格式化日期。

=IIF(IsNothing(CStr(Fields!VPSR_Actual_Date.Value)) OR CStr(Fields!VPSR_Actual_Date.Value) ="", "TBC", Format(Fields!VPSR_Actual_Date.Value, "dd-MMM-yyyy"))